I have no idea if you will be ready or not. For one I never took a CLEP ever, I have only taken a DSST; however, I would presume if you dedicate yourself and put forth the effort you will be fine. Though I have only taken one DSST, I have taken a multitude of comprehensive examinations throughout my life. My technique is to start out with a practice test, make note cards for what I got wrong, review a bit, take a different practice test, repeat. I figure if I can get at least a high passing score on 3 different practice exams then I can pass the real test. So far that technique has worked.

Social Science CLEP - BGSU_Alum_86 - 02-02-2015

^^Are you thinking to take one of the History exams instead of the Social Science & History exam or in addition to it? There is no extra fee if you are thinking to replace it. If you have already registered for the SS&H exam on your CLEP account, you are able to request a refund (I believe it may be under an edit/change link) and then submit a new registration for the History exam you hope to take instead. Now if you intend on taking both (and have registered for the SS&H), make note of your expiration date (6 months from the date you registered).
